As I have finally come out of the lurker cupboard I though I might as well break the "start a thread" virginity too.

Being a spurs fan for over 30 years now and like most seasoned yids I have lots of good and a few bad memories of the lane. One bad experience I want to share and get off my chest and see if it will lose some of its pain.

23rd December 1978, Home v goons.

I had just started to visit the lane, via the pub, with my mates as a 16 year old, nothing unusual in that only my Dad is a lifelong Gooner.

I cant remember exactly when but i remember queuing up at a previous home match with my mate and we managed to get a couple of tickets each, my extra was for my dad.

When Dad went to footie he always ended up in the players lounge (yes they did exist) in Highbury as he was drinking buddies with Alan Sunderland, so he was slumming it on the Paxton road terrace with me and my mates.

I am not going into detail but we lost 0-5, Stapleton scored one, Brady scored a "classic" and Sunderland got a hat-trick, and so started 34 years of "He never took me again"

jI hope none of you have had this level of humiliation but would be interested in other peoples painful memories of the lane?

COYS
